What is Camms GRC?
Camms GRC is a powerful, cloud-based governance, risk, and compliance platform designed to unify risk functions under one roof while aligning them seamlessly with business objectives. Recognized for its flexibility and ease of use, Camms.Risk offers rapid time to value and supports a fully integrated approach to managing enterprise risk, compliance, audit, and resilience. The platform enables organizations to improve information flow, enhance visibility, and make informed decisions through effective reporting. With support for areas such as ESG, business continuity, health & safety, and third-party risk, Camms delivers scalable solutions across sectors globally. What buyers should know before shortlisting Camms GRC
Camms GRC is a robust and forward-looking platform that has impressed me with its ability to consolidate diverse governance, risk, and compliance functions into a single, easy-to-use interface. Its scalability and modular design make it suitable for both public and private sector organizations worldwide.
I found its intuitive design and rapid deployment particularly valuable for teams looking to gain quick wins in risk and compliance management. While the learning curve exists for some advanced features, and smaller teams might find the cost a factor, Camms offers a comprehensive, future-ready solution that empowers organizations to manage uncertainty with confidence.
Camms GRC pros and cons
- Camms GRC pros
Unified platform consolidating risk, compliance, audit, and resilience functions
Excellent flexibility allowing tailored modules with intuitive user experience
Rapid deployment enabling fast time to value and quick ROI
- Camms GRC cons
Advanced customization may require consultant support or experienced admins
Limited offline access due to fully cloud-based architecture
